Iraqis carry a body from the site of the suicide car bombing that hit the Karada district of Baghdad. Iraqis react at the site of the bombing, claimed by ISIS in Baghdad's central Karada district. Within hours, ISIS claimed responsibility for the bombing in a statement posted online, saying they had deliberately targeted Shia Muslims. On May 11, ISIS militants carried out three car bombings in Baghdad, killing 93 people. The security can't focus on the war (against ISIS) and forget Baghdad," Sami, the street vendor, said.
